4 SLLI on Anniversary Day Invokes Blessings

The 4 Sri Lanka Light Infantry Regiment (SLLI) celebrated its 36th anniversary on Friday (5) at its HQ in Dambulla with several events.

The anniversary programme began with religious observances at Temple of the Tooth Relic, Matale Sri Muththu Amman Hindu Kovil, and St.Anthony’s Church at Wahakotte, prior to the anniversary day where blessings were invoked.

On the anniversary Day, a ceremonial Guard Turnout was presented to the Commanding Officer of 4 SLLI, Lieutenant Colonel W.D.D.R Weerapura. Afterwards, the Commanding Officer customarily addressed troops and joined an All Rank lunch.

4 SLLI Regiment was established on 5th May 1987 and the troops of 4 SLLI actively participated in the three decades of war in Sri Lanka. 21 Officers and 314 soldiers sacrificed their lives for defence of the sovereignty of the motherland.
